Abstract(s)

The contracting-expanding soccer teams' relationship is one of the most important dynamic behaviors of the game. Therefore, a soccer game was analyzed using the centroid and stretch index method, while recording the team's ball possession status (with or without ball possession). The correlation test suggest an inverse relationship between opposing teams (r _(1508)=- 0.054) during all game. When considering ball possession by the teams, the results of the stretch index confirm that there are statistical differences with a small effect between the moments with and without possession of the ball for team B (F_(1; 1506)=22.777; p-value≤0.001; η^2=0.015; Power=0.998). Therefore, it was possible to confirm that the contracting -expanding relationship is an intrinsic behaviour of a soccer game in relation to ball possession.
